Jackson Lab to receive $2.7 million federal grant to study Alzheimer’s

May 17, 2017

Alzheimer’s, the most common form of dementia, affects more than 5 million Americans.

(Reprint from Bangor Daily News 5/16/2017) BAR HARBOR – The Jackson Laboratory, over the next five years, will receive $2.7 million in grant money to study the connection between healthy aging and the development of Alzheimer’s disease. Read more here.
